According to the world health organization, about how many of the world's people suffer from serious illness caused by poverty? a. 1 million b. 10 million c. 1 billion d. 10 billion socialogy test

  • jamuuj: According to the world health organization about one billion people in the world suffer from serious illness caused by poverty. Illnesses or diseases of poverty are diseases, disabilities and health conditions that are more prevalent among the poor population as compared to the wealthier people. Poverty is considered the major risk factor of such diseases. The contributing factors include; contaminated water, inadequate sanitation, poor nutrition and poverty itself. These diseases include, TB, AIDS, Malaria, Asthma, etc
